A cooling vest or ice vest or precool vest is a piece of equipment worn to cool a person down. Cooling vests are used by many athletes, industry workers, doctors, working dogs, people with Multiple Sclerosis or Hypohidrotic ectodermal dysplasia , and by military pilots and tank crews. Olympic Games Olympic sportsperson athlete s use the lightweight body cooling vest to pre cool before events. In advance of the Beijing Olympics in 2008, Nike developed the Nike Precool Vest for Olympic athletes. Intended to be worn for an hour prior to events in the hot and humid conditions in Beijing, Nike reported an expected increase of 21 in an athletes endurance. ref name gizmodo.com http gizmodo.com 386872 nike precool vest is heatsink for athletes ref Other research backs up the improved performance claims. ref name gizmodo.com Vests range in weight from around two to eight pounds, depending on the model. The Nike model is not sold to the public and no information is available. However a number of commercial products of varying weight and cost are available. Some, like the RiteTemp Performance Vest and Hyper Precool Vest, utilize standard cooling gel packs or phase change material, and are designed to hold to the body during movement allowing full normal warm up activity. Cooling vests can use a number of methods. Some modern vests use the adiabatic expansion of compressed air , and can cool a worker for long periods in very hot conditions. Jack Vest 1926 1972 was an American athlete. He was a 12 letter man for East Tennessee State , winning honors in football, basketball and baseball between the years 1946 50. He is also to be found numerous times in the Buccaneer record book. He was an outstanding quarterback in football and averaged between 15 20 points per season in basketball. A gifted passer, Vest held the Buccaneer record for most passes completed in a single game for years. He was a member of the All Decade 1940 s team as a quarterback and figured prominently in some of the better teams fielded by Coach L.T. Roberts. Vest is a member of the East Tennessee State Athletic Hall of Fame. After leaving East Tennessee State, Vest coached high school football and turned out a 9 0 1 record with a St. Paul, Virginia team which had only 17 players on the entire squad. He coached at Greeneville from 1951 53. While he was an accomplished athlete in college, Vest will more likely be remembered as one of the nation s most outstanding officials in both football and basketball. After coaching football at Hanes High School in Winston Salem, North Carolina , he became an executive in the insurance department of Wachovia Bank and devoted much time to officiating. Unreferenced stub auto yes date December 2009 A vest frottoir is an instrument used in zydeco music . It is usually made from pressed, corrugated aluminium and is worn over the shoulders. It is played as a rhythm instrument by stroking either bottle openers or spoons down it. Many of these instruments are home made, but Don Landry of Louisiana is a renowned maker of frottoirs or rub boards as they are also known making them for Clifton Chenier s band and Elvis Fontenot and the Sugar Bees, amongst others. Mergeto straitjacket date August 2010 A Posey vest is a type of medical restraint used to restrain a patient to a bed Types of beds bed or chair ref http books.google.com books?id 0SXq4vuQM6oC&pg PA73&dq posey vest&lr &ie ISO 8859 1&output html&sig ACfU3U2BfEiExumazTC9nVcRfldvvWlWJg ref . Its name comes from the J.T. Posey Company , its inventor, though the term Posey is used generically to describe all such devices ref http books.google.com books?id ESLkeLj9kHoC&pg PA314&dq posey vest&ie ISO 8859 1&output html&sig ACfU3U2dFC7YpIHU5q5dWRA4dSBqtu8bEg ref . The vest is placed on the patient, and meshy straps extending from each corner are tied either individually to each side of the bed or together to the back of a chair. Poseys are most often used to prevent patients from injuring themselves by falling or climbing out of the bed or chair ref http books.google.com books?id xoTxUSYU CQC&pg PA97&dq posey vest&lr &ie ISO 8859 1&output html&sig ACfU3U2HUY JPBjWlIRHN8KMQR9KeT01kA ref . They allow patients the freedom to move around their arms and legs if no limb restraint s have been applied. Laws in many places require Posey vests be applied with the opening at the patient s front. Misuse in which a Posey vest is applied backwards has resulted in patients being choked to death ref http books.google.com books?id HXWmZ9cdBbsC&pg PA66&lpg PA66&dq limb restraint&source web&ots f Z JjyMzU&sig OB8gjbSqb4MNIg2ADajT5N9 TFo&hl en&sa X&oi book result&resnum 4&ct result ref . Many lawsuits have been litigated in which a patient has died while restrained by a Posey. Variations A cushion belt is a belt that does not include a vest, and simply fastens around the waist, and is tied to the sides of a bed or to a chair. An alternate version of the Posey is a vest that is placed on with an opening in the back and a back zipper , and straps that extend from the sides. Vest Recklinghausen was an ecclesiastical territory in the Holy Roman Empire , located in the center of today s North Rhine Westphalia . The rivers Emscher and Lippe formed the border with the County of Mark and Essen Abbey in the south , and to the Bishopric of M nster in the north. In the east, a fortification secured the border with Dortmund and in the west it was bordered by the Duchy of Cleves . Today Vest Recklinghausen is part of the district of Recklinghausen , with parts of Gelsenkirchen , Oberhausen and Bottrop now added to the administration of Vest Recklinghausen. The term Vest , describing a judicial district, is still used locally, for instance in a local radio station and in a local museum.
